Spaghetti Sauce Seasoning Mix

1/2 c Onion flakes
1/2 c Parsley flakes
2 tb Dried oregano, crumbled
2 tb Sugar
1 tb Each of dried thyme and
-basil, crumbled
2 ts Black pepper
1 ts Garlic flakes
4 lg Bay leaves, crumbled fine.

from: Reader's Digest Great recipes for Good Health

You can cut the time it takes to make spaghetti sauce by keeping this mix
on hand. And its better for you than sodium-laden store bought brands.

Place all the ingredients in a 1 pint jar, cover tightly and shake well to
mix. store in a cool ,dark dry place for up to 2 months. Makes about 1 1/2
cups

SPAGHETTI SAUCE: In a medium sized heavy saucepan over moderate heat, mix
together 2 cans (28 oz each) low sodium tomatoes, drained and chopped, 1
can (6 oz) low sodium tomato paste, and 1 cup water. Stir in 1/2 cup of
Spaghetti Sauce seasoning mix. Reduce the heat and simmer, uncovered, for
20 minutes, stirring occasionally. Spoon over spaghetti and other pasta.
note: for spaghetti sauce with meat, brown 1 pound of very lean ground beef
or turkey and drain off any fat before adding the other ingredients and
proceeding as directed. serves 4

1/2 cup mix : calories 72 Fat 0 sodium 6mg
